How they compare

Germany currently reports 49.5% against 48.5% in Georgia, a difference of 1.0%.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 16 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Georgia ahead.

Georgia ranks 26th and Germany ranks 24th of 111 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 2 and Germany in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Georgia Germany Difference Ahead
2000s 92.1% 46.5% 45.7% Georgia
2010s 74.5% 46.9% 27.6% Georgia
2020s 43.5% 48.6% 5.1% Germany

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Part-time employment rate represents the percentage of employment that is part time. Part time employment in this series is based on a common definition of less than 35 actual weekly hours worked.
